How Much Is a Private ADHD Assessment?
If you'd like to be able to reduce the time it takes to get an ADHD assessment, you can do so by choosing to pay privately. This is known as your Right to Choose, and it is an option available to any registered GP in England.
It is important to remember that the diagnosis of ADHD should be made by an healthcare professional who is an expert in ADHD. This includes GPs and Consultant psychiatrists.

If you are covered by private health insurance it is important to review the terms and conditions of your policy to determine if it covers ADHD assessments. Many of the major insurance companies do not provide ADHD assessments, such as AXA PPP, Bupa and Aviva. They typically only cover mental disorders of acute nature and not neurodevelopmental issues like ADHD.
Waiting several times
ADHD is a mental health disorder that is characterized by hyperactivity, inattention and an impulsiveness. These symptoms can be experienced by anyone, but are more prominent in young children and adolescents. However the majority of people aren't diagnosed until they reach a certain age. The number of adults seeking diagnosis through the NHS has risen significantly. The growing awareness of the disorder is a primary reason, but there is also a lack of services. Waiting times for ADHD tests on the NHS are currently lengthy. In some cases, patients are waiting for more than four years before being assessed. ADHD UK requested Freedom of Information and discovered that adults in Northern Ireland waited the longest for an appointment and were followed by those in Wales and England.
Experts have expressed concern over the growing demand for private ADHD assessments. Some experts believe that the BBC Panorama investigation revealed private clinics that provide inaccurate diagnoses. Others have claimed that the report revealed the absence of public health services for ADHD.
